B The Product

Gunshot is a top-down dungeon crawler for personal computers, built on the studio's own engine. Its floors are generated for each run, and progress within a run does not carry over to the next.

Gunshot is intended for release through the personal-computer stores the studio publishes through. You obtain the title, and pay for it or for anything within it, through the store and not from us. The store's own terms apply to you as that company's agreement, and section 11 of the body explains what they mean for this one.

CEDRA Interactive publishes Gunshot and is your counterparty for it under section 2 of the body, whichever store you obtain it from and whatever the store's page says about the developer.

The title's age rating, its content descriptors and its hardware requirements are stated on its store page for the territory you buy in. Those statements describe the title; they are not a warranty, and section 17 of the body applies to them.

C Licence

Under section 7 of the body we grant you a limited, personal, non-exclusive, non-transferable and revocable licence to install and play Gunshot on devices you control, for your own personal and non-commercial entertainment. The licence covers the title as we supply it, including the updates we issue for it.

The licence is not a sale. It gives you no right in the title's code, assets, characters or audio beyond playing it, and it ends when your access ends under section 16 of the body or when the licence is otherwise revoked as that section allows.

You may install the title on more than one device you control and play it offline where the title supports that, unless the store you obtained it from provides otherwise. You may not transfer the licence or the account holding it to another person, except where the store you bought through operates a transfer we are bound to honour.

Video, Streaming and Screenshots

You may record, stream and publish footage of your own play of Gunshot, including on channels that pay you for it, provided that the material is your own commentary or performance rather than a substitute for the title, that it does not present itself as published or endorsed by the studio, and that it complies with section 8 of the body. This permission is given freely, may be withdrawn for a particular use, and does not transfer any right in the title.

You may not distribute the title's assets on their own, sell footage as a product in itself, or use the title's name or marks in a way that suggests a partnership, sponsorship or endorsement that does not exist.

E How the Title May Be Used

Section 8 of the body states the conduct rules that apply across everything we operate. For this title they mean, in particular, that you may not:

  • use cheats, trainers, automation or any tool that alters how the title behaves, or exploit a defect for advantage;
  • interfere with another player's session, or with the servers or services the title relies on;
  • extract, scrape or republish the title's content, or use it to train a model or build a competing product;
  • use the title, or an account holding it, to sell services, advertise, or run anything commercial that we have not licensed in writing.

Where a title has competitive elements, detection of cheating may be automated; a suspension or ban that affects your access is reviewed by a person before it takes effect, and section 16 of the body governs how it is applied and contested.

F Payment, Virtual Items and Refunds

Payment for this title, and for anything offered inside it, is taken by the store you bought through. We set no price at checkout, hold no card details and issue no receipt: those are the store's, and section 10 of the body governs purchases generally.

Where the title offers virtual items, currency or unlockable content, they are licensed to you as part of the title and are not owned by you, have no monetary value outside the title, and cannot be exchanged for money or transferred except where the title itself provides a way to do so. Ending your licence ends your access to them.

Refunds are handled by the store under its own policy, and your statutory rights as a consumer, including any right of withdrawal, are set out in the annex for your jurisdiction. Where a store refunds a purchase, the licence that purchase carried ends with it.

G Data

The privacy notice published on this site states how CEDRA Interactive handles personal data, and it applies to Gunshot in full. Section 14 of the body ties the two documents together.

In this title we process what running it requires: game state so that a save works, crash data so that defects can be fixed, and telemetry where you have agreed to it. Where the title asks for optional telemetry, the in-title privacy screen is where the permission is given or withdrawn, and the choice persists between sessions.

The store you bought through is a separate company and a separate controller for the account, payment and device data it holds about you. We receive from it only an account or player identifier, the display name attached to it and entitlement information. Card numbers, bank details and billing addresses do not reach us.
